Synopsis:
Ovid’s classic stories of the loves, losses, and transformations of gods and mortals are reimagined for the 21st century in Mary Zimmerman’s adaptation. Juxtaposing the mythic and the modern, the stories of Aphrodite, Midas, Cupid, and others are told in a whimsical and poignant fashion, reminding us that the joys, follies, and heartbreaks of being human are universal.
